Witton Castle Lakes Week Ending 18.11.07

Extremely cold week along with short dark nights are not conducive to fishing, we should be all infront of the fire with a nice glass of malt. However anglers braving the elements have been rewarded with fish in the 2 to 5lb bracket, with no big fish being taken, although they are cruising the margin's gorging up for the long winter period, which is surely upon us all. A Black Zonker fished in the margins similiar to Blyth Palmers method at Jubilee Lakes is catching fish upto 5lbs, but the remaining big fish are turning at the last minute, maybe they can see our extended shadows out into water ,during the brighter period of the day. One particular angler believe this or not , fishing a Hares Ear Klinkhammer just in the ripple had a superb day, went off with a smile on his face, whilst other anglers struggled with all variations of lures. 
The suprise of the week was a nice conditioned 6lb Goldie which the cormorants have not yet got, never been seen before by the angler

     A photo from a mobile phone of Duncan Pallister's Goldie.


Duncan Pallister from Hunwick, who carefully returned it, lured by a Dawsons Olive.
Terry Ross from Willington secured a nice bag at 5, 4, and 3lb. along with Kevin Clark from Wardley at 4lb 4oz, 2lb 8oz, and 2lb 8ozs.
Roy Richley from Birmingham on his first visit to the area commented on the quaulity of the fish, and left with fish of 4lbs 4ozs, 3, and 2lb.
Not big fish ,but quality, fully finned fighting fit.
